Semi-Truck Collision Causes Major Train Derailment in Poweshiek County

Highway 21 is expected to remain closed for several days as crews clear wreckage and investigators seek the cause.

Overview

  • The crash between a semi-truck and a train near Highway 21 between Brooklyn and Victor caused a derailment Wednesday and prompted a large emergency response.
  • Poweshiek County officials confirmed the semi-truck driver was killed and a passenger was flown to a hospital with serious injuries while train occupants suffered only minor injuries.
  • Authorities say more than 20 rail cars left the tracks, leaving heavy damage to the railroad and gouging the roadway where cars left their wheels.
  • Crews remain on scene clearing wreckage and repairing the tracks and road, and the Iowa Department of Transportation has closed Highway 21 in both directions with closures expected to last several days.
  • Investigators are in the early stages of probing the cause and are checking whether the crossing warning lights worked and whether the semi’s load of a large John Deere tractor contributed to knocking cars off the rails.
